Colorado College Mountain Club

Publication Year: 1975.

Colorado College Mountain Club. The CCMC experienced a highly successful year thanks to the efforts of enthusiastic members and our president, Laurie Rehnebohm. Notable climbs included the east face of Crestone Needle by Ken and Lester Michaels; Kurt Haire’s solo effort on the northeast buttress of Holy Cross; and Greg Twombly’s ascent of Devils Tower. The Blanca Peak jinx struck A1 Erickson and me, as incredible rockfall and other problems aborted our attempt on the standard north face route. Club rock climbers also did many classic ascents at local crags. Pete Koscumb is in Africa, where he visited the Mountains of the Moon and Kilimanjaro. During the year the club sponsored a rousing Mountaineer’s Weekend, a Wilderness Film Festival, and slide shows by Royal Robbins and Jim Dunne. In the planning stages for the coming year are a climbing guide to the Garden of the Gods, a TV production on rock climbing, and an expedition to climb Orizaba in Mexico.

Jim McChristal
